Which of the following does NOT belong to the axial skeleton?
A
Vertebrae
B
Sternum
C
Femur
D
Ribs

Step 1: Understand the axial skeleton. The axial skeleton consists of the bones that form the central axis of the body, including the skull, vertebrae, ribs, and sternum. It provides support and protection for the brain, spinal cord, and thoracic organs.
Step 2: Identify the components listed in the question. The options provided are vertebrae, sternum, femur, and ribs. Compare each option to the definition of the axial skeleton.
Step 3: Recognize that the vertebrae, sternum, and ribs are part of the axial skeleton. These bones contribute to the central framework of the body and are involved in protecting vital organs.
Step 4: Understand the femur's classification. The femur is a long bone located in the thigh and is part of the appendicular skeleton, which includes the limbs and girdles. It does not belong to the axial skeleton.
Step 5: Conclude that the femur is the correct answer because it is not part of the axial skeleton, unlike the vertebrae, sternum, and ribs.
